iPad Release Date: March 26 2010?

ipad release dateApple hasn’t officially confirmed this release date for their Apple iPad, however rumours in the tech world suggest that March 26th could be a likely date for us to get our mitts on the must have Apple device of 2010.

The Examiner as well as tech blog, MacRumors heard from several insider sources that the Apple Stores could be selling the iPad on Friday, 26th at 6pm. If rumours are true then it would appear that Apple have placed this date at the best time possible, especially as the end of the month usually means payday for a large majority of people.

As a run up to the rumoured release date of March 26th, Apple will begin delivering their iPads units to stores on March 10th and product training with advertising on March 15th.

This definitely ties into what Apple has said all along, that the shipping date of the iPad 3G will be in late March, however it was only a few days ago when an analyst spread a rumour which suggested that tight inventories might delay the iPad for the end of March release date.
